Job description

Villa At Parkridge is seeking a Maintenance Director to join their team! The Maintenance Director is responsible for the Environmental Services Assistants and full maintenance of the inside and outside of the facility.

Maintenance Director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Responsible for recruitment, training, clinical orientation, supervision, scheduling, timecards, and personnel issues in the department.
  • Communicates on a regular basis with the Administrator who is responsible for ensuring that the facility physical plant equipment is functioning.
  • Leads facility inspection tours and is able to meet with Village inspectors.
  • Performs snow and ice removal as directed.
  • Performs minor tile, wallpaper, painting, and drywall repairs.
  • Performs gardening and lawn care duties.
  • Repairs and replaces door and window hardware.
  • Maintains and repairs pumps.
  • Perform all preventative maintenance.
  • Maintains accurate documentation as directed.
  • May be required to assist at other facilities, as directed by management.
  • All other duties as assigned.

Maintenance DirectorQualifications and Skills:

  • The ability to make carpentry, electrical, HVAC and plumbing repairs.
  • Strong documentation skills.
  • Ability to read, write, speak and understand English.
  • High level of PC literacy preferred.
  • The ability to budget the needs of the department.

Maintenance Director Education and Experience:

  • Experience performing maintenance duties in a healthcare facility or industrial setting required.
  • Associate’s degree, trade program certificates, or equivalent in work experience required.
  • Bachelor’s degree in facility management, engineering, or health and environmental services preferred.

Physical Requirements:

  • Walking, reaching, bending, grasping, fine hand coordination, pushing and pulling, ability to distinguish smells and temperatures, all with or without the aid of mechanical devices is required.
  • Must be able to push, pull move and/or lift a minimum of 50 pounds to a minimum height of 5 feet and be able to push, pull, move and/or carry such weight a minimum distance of 50 feet.
  • Must be able to walk, utilize a ladder, and work on the facility roof.
